Paid Summer Undergraduate Student Research Opportunity in Cell Manufacturing

Deadline
Friday, February 15, 2019 - 12:00

The NSF Engineering Research Center for
Cell Manufacturing Technologies (CMaT)
announces its Research Experience for
Undergraduates (REU) program for summer

2019. The REU program will fund under-
graduate students to work in CMaT labs at

Georgia Institute of Technology (GT),
University of Georgia (UGA), University of
Puerto Rico at Mayagüez (UPRM), and
University of Wisconsin-Madison (UW).

What CMaT REU Offers:
• 10 weeks of hands-on research at GT, UGA,
UPRM, or UW
• $4500 - $5000 stipend per student
• Free housing and allowances for meals and
travel
• Grad school prep, faculty mentoring, professional
development, and social engagement with other
students on campus
• Networking with partner REUs
• Multiple presentation opportunities including the
CMaT annual retreat

Application deadline: February 15, 2019
Program Requirements:
• Must be 18 years or older and a U.S. citizen or permanent resident
• Must be currently enrolled in a science or engineering undergraduate program (biology,
chemistry, physics, materials science, bioengineering, computer science, and related fields)
• Students from underrepresented minority groups, women, and individuals with disabilities are strongly encouraged to apply
